Transistor time relay circuit 2
The power supply circuit of the stereo low-frequency amplifier is connected with a large-capacity filter capacitor. When this type of power supply is connected to the power grid,
the rectifier diode and transformer may be overloaded due to the large capacitor charging current. In order to avoid this accident, a time delay relay composed of a triode can be connected to the low
discharge power supply circuit .
The delayed power-on time is determined by Ri and cl. Usually there is a 1-2s delay.
